linux下的一切都是文件
红帽软件管理器(RPM)
1.源代码+安装规定的集合.目的:降低安装难度
2.RPM仅在红帽中使用此名称,不同系统中类似功能的名称不同
3.RPM类似于windows系统中的控制面板,建立统一的数据库文件,记录软件信息并自动分析依赖关系(不能解决所有依赖关系)
4常见的RPM命令
命令 | 作用 |
---|---|
rpm-ivh filenme.rpm | 安装软件 |
rpm-Uvh filenme.rpm | 升级软件 |
rpm-e filenme.rpm | 卸载软件 |
rpm-qpi filenme.rpm | 咨询软件描述信息 |
rpm-qpl filenme.rpm | 列出软件文件信息 |
rpm-qf filenme.rpm | 查询文件属于哪个RPM |
YUM软件仓库
1.作用:将大量的RPM打包到一起,进一步降低安装难度自动解决依赖关系
2.常用的YUM命令
命令 | 作用 |
---|---|
yum list all | 列出仓库中所有软件包 |
yum info | 查看软件包信息 |
yum install | 重新安装软件包 |
yum update | 升级软件包 |
yum remove | 移除软件包 |
systemd初始化进程
初始化进程的一些常用命令
命令 | 服务名称 |
---|---|
systemctl restart foo.service | 重启服务 |
systemctl start | 启动服务 |
systemctl stop | 停止服务 |
systemctl ewable | 加入到启动项 |
systemctl status | 查看服务状态 |
systemctl reload | 重新加载配置文件 |
systemctl reload和systemctl start都是用来重启服务的,区别在于systemctl start重启之后PID的值会发生变化,而systemctl reload重启之后不会发生变化(只进行加载)
文章知识点与官方知识档案匹配,可进一步学习相关知识CS入门技能树Linux入门初识Linux24757 人正在系统学习中
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!